Thank you for your answer Ingo.
I bought animals from Michael Kiesel of "Gecko" from Oldenburg. I'm not sure which subspecies they are, since papers say only "T. lepidus (Perleidechse)". Several days ago I bought Osram HQL-R lamps with colour temperature of 3500K, and light intesity 3000 lm. I've been talking with some marine aquarists about usage of metal-halide lamps and they talked me out of it since they, apparently, produce a huge amount of heat and it's a real risk for terrarium to become overheated.
